K-Shell Line Distribution of Heavy Elements along the Galactic Plane Observed with Suzaku

Abstract

We report on the global distribution of the intensities of the K-shell lines from He-like and H-like ions of S, Ar, Ca, and Fe along the Galactic plane. From the profiles, we clearly separate the Galactic center X-ray emission (GCXE) and the Galactic ridge X-ray emission (GRXE). The intensity profiles of the He-like Kα lines of S, Ar, Ca, and Fe along the Galactic plane are approximately similar to each other, while not for the H-like Lyα lines. In particular, the profiles of H-like Lyα of S and Fe show remarkable contrast: a large excess of Fe, and almost no excess of S lines in GCXE compared to GRXE. Although the prominent K-shell lines are represented by ∼1 keV and ∼7 keV temperature plasmas, these two temperatures are not equal between GCXE and GRXE. In fact, a spectral analysis of GCXE and GRXE revealed that the ∼1 keV plasma in GCXE has a lower temperature than that in GRXE, and vice versa for the ∼7 keV plasma.
